   He got a piece of paper and pen to try and piece what he ignored over the years. He searched his memories, wiped the tears off his cheeks, and began to write. Maleva always warned him to never take the amulet off his neck, for protection she says. But from what? She never really answered him and tends to dance around the subject. The salt spread around the house, the fearful prayers, numerous beads and rosaries hanged from every corner. She always was fearful when the sun sets, and even when they were younger she'd make sure that they would be inside the house before dusk. She would waste money on sacks of salt and spread it in thick lines around the house, the locks and all those locks for only two doors. The gates too had numerous locks and before going to bed, despite his age, Maleva would gather them to pray. And since his father forsook them, they never knew any family member that they could go to for visit. There were only the three of them. Sigmund never remembered his encounter with the stranger he came across on the road that night. Nor did he remember anything that came after that, how he got home, or what it did to him that he still made his way in one piece. All he remembered was he was walk ing from the construction site and arriving at the pharmacy to make some purchase, nothing in between. He rose from his seat and reached for the day's newspaper lying above the coffee table.
